主要内容

本页采用了机器翻译。点击此处可查看最新英文版本。

需求可追溯性

MATLAB 编辑器中管理当前文件的外部链接

自 R2025a 起

说明

使用需求可追溯性面板在 MATLAB® 编辑器中管理当前文件的外部链接,而无需打开需求编辑器。您可以跳转到关联的代码行和链接目标,查看链接详细信息,并删除链接。

This image shows the Requirements Traceability panel. The panel contains 11 line ranges and 11 links.

打开 需求可追溯性

  • MATLAB 编辑器:在编辑纯文本文件时,右键点击编辑器并选择 Requirements > 打开需求可追溯性面板

示例

全部展开

要在 MATLAB 编辑器中跳转到链接的代码行,请打开需求可追溯性面板,然后点击带有链接目标图标 的项。MATLAB 编辑器选择链接的代码行。

A GIF shows the mouse clicking an item that has the line range icon and the MATLAB Editor highlights the linked lines of code.

如果需求与文件中错误的代码行相关联,您可以编辑行范围.

要编辑某一行范围内的行号:

  1. 选择带有线范围图标 的项。编辑器选择行范围内的代码。

  2. 在编辑器中点击要取消选择的代码行范围。然后,在行范围内右键点击,并选择 Requirements > Adjust line range

  3. 在调整范围对话框中,使用+-按钮更改行范围的第一行和最后一行。或者,在字段中输入行号。

    Adjust range dialog box showing lines 1 and 2 as the first and last lines for the line range.

  4. 点击确定

  5. 在 MATLAB 编辑器中右键点击链接,然后选择Requirements > 保存链接以保存该链接.

如果当前文件包含未使用的行范围,您可以删除它们。要执行此操作,请选择带有线范围图标 的项,然后按下 Delete。如果线段范围包含出站链接,系统将弹出对话框提示您是否同时删除出站链接,或取消操作。

要保存更改,请在编辑器中右键点击链接,然后选择 Requirements > 保存链接

要跳转到链接目标,请选择带有链接目标图标 的项,然后点击在文档中显示

A looping GIF selects an item with the link destination icon, then opens the link destination by clicking the Show in document button.

要查看链接目标的详细信息,请点击带有链接目标图标 的项。您可以查看链接类型、链接目标文件及域名,以及链接目标 ID。

An item that has the link destination is selected. The link details are displayed.

要查看未在需求可追溯性面板中显示的链接属性,请在需求编辑器中打开该链接。在需求可追溯性面板中,双击带有链接目标图标 的项。

A looping GIF shows the mouse double-clicking an item that has the link destination icon and the link opens in the Requirements Editor.

要删除一个链接,请选择带有链接目标图标 的项,然后按下 Delete

然后,在编辑器中右键点击链接,选择 Requirements > 保存链接 保存该链接。

要生成关联代码行之间的可追溯性图,请双击带有行范围图标 的项。图的起始节点是线段范围。有关详细信息,请参阅生成可追溯性图

A looping GIF demonstrates generating a traceability diagram by double-clicking an item that has the line range icon.

孤链是指来源无效的链接。如果从 MATLAB 代码文件中删除已链接的代码行,则这些链接的来源将失效。需求可追溯性面板以红色文字显示孤链。

The mouse points to the section of the panel that displays the orphan items in the link set.

要修复孤链,请执行以下操作:

  1. 双击带有线范围图标 的孤项。“修复无效链接”对话框出现。

  2. 在 MATLAB 编辑器中,选择要链接的代码行。

  3. 在“修复无效链接”对话框中,点击使用当前

  4. 点击确定

  5. 在 MATLAB 编辑器中右键点击链接,然后选择Requirements > 保存链接以保存该链接.

有关链接修复的更多信息,请参阅 加载和解析链接

提示

或者,您可以删除孤链并创建新链接。有关创建链接的更多信息,请参阅 创建链接.

版本历史记录

在 R2025a 中推出